Materials
Measuring cup
Bowl 2 cups (500 mL) of flour
1 teaspoon (5 mL) of salt
2/3 cup (165 mL) of oil
4-5 tablespoons (60-75 mL) of water
Fork Cooking spray Cookie sheet Oven Jam or peanut butter SpoonsInstructions
1. Have the children help measure and pour the flour, salt, oil, and water into a bowl. Let them
have a turn mixing the ingredients with their hands or a fork.
2. Encourage the children to roll the dough into small balls and lay them on a greased cookie
sheet. Have the children push their thumbprints into the balls.
3. Bake the cookies at 325 degree F (160 degree C) for 10 minutes.
4. Let the cookies cool, and have the children fill the thumbprint centers with jam or peanut butter.
